TROY, MI — Grammer AG – Automotive, a supplier of specialty automotive seating systems, has received a 2003 Best Supplier Award from Volkswagen’s Truck and Bus Division.

Grammer’s Atibaia, Brazil operations produce all Volkswagen bus and truck seats manufactured in Brazil. Four companies out of Volkswagen’s more than 350 suppliers were selected for the recognition.

“Grammer’s product teams in Brazil and Germany share this honor,” says Juergen Huertgen, Grammer’s vice president, sales and marketing, Americas. “Together, they worked hard to support Volkswagen’s manufacturing operations.”

The Atibaia facility also produces fully trimmed head restraints for the Golf A4, Polo and the Audi A3, all built by Volkswagen in Curitiba and Sao Paolo, Brazil.

The 215,000-square-foot Grammer plant in Atibaia has supplied Volkswagen in Brazil since 1989. It is ISO/TS 16949 certified and its 450 employees operate under strict lean principles. Cut and sew, stamping and assembly, banding, welding, painting and foaming operations are supported by a small prototype shop.

Grammer do Brasil LTDA’s bus and tractor seating customers in Brazil also include Komatsu, AGCO, Case New Holland, John Deere, DaimlerChrysler, Navistar, Scania, Ford, Marcopolo, Valtra and Agrale.
